When making resolutions, make it reasonable, consider making gradual changes, and be persistent; forgive yourself for slipping-up, but keep trying to stick to your goals. Here’s a list of 10 resolutions that work:
1) Gradually increase exercise or physical activity to 3-4 hours a week or at least 30 minutes a day.
2) Try 1 new fruit or vegetable per week or substitute refined carbohydrates (e.g white bread, pasta, or rice) with whole grain sources.
3) Carry around a standard size water bottle (approximately 20 ounces) and aim to refill it twice a day.
4) Decrease sugar and caloric intake in alcoholic and other beverages. Opt for lighter alternatives (e.g diet soda or light beer).

A can of beer is ~150 calories; light beer is ~100 calories

A can of soda is ~200 calories; diet soda 0 calories!

Rum and soda is ~300 calories; rum and diet soda is ~100 calories
5) Aim to sleep 6-8 hours a night; try to be consistent in bed time and the time you wake up.
6) Eat a small breakfast within 1 hour of waking up. Pack or carry a small snack with you if you are short on time in the morning.
7) Floss at least once a day.
8) Join an exercise class with a friend and encourage each other to go regularly.
9) Make small lifestyle changes.

Take the stairs once a day.

Park a block farther than where you usually park.

Walk to class instead of driving.
10) Eat smart.

Avoid mindless eating (i.e eating in front of the TV)

Choose smaller servings in dining halls and fast-food restaurants

Opt for low-fat or lighter food options (i.e choose grilled over fried, substitute regular for low-fat dressings, limit desserts or choose fruit and frozen yogurt for dessert)
